TICKET-4471: Signature check failed on ContrastKit audit bundle

The nightly color-contrast accessibility audit (ContrastKit v3.2) failed signature verification on the Pellbrook pipeline. Audit results for the dashboard refresh are blocked. Root cause: bundle was signed with the retired October key. Re-sign and re-upload before Thursday's eng sync so WCAG results land in the report. Verification should pass against the current signing key:

rollout seal: bky4_x7Gc

Ticket: Staging env misconfigured for Siftgate bloom filter

The bloom layer in front of the Pellet KV store is rejecting all lookups in staging because the env file was copied from the dev template without credentials. False-positive tuning values are fine; only the auth line is missing. To unblock the weekly demo, the Pellet admission secret must be set on the following line.

env line for yaguf-fajop: LEDGER_TOKEN13=fb08984397349

Step 7: Normalize build-agent clocks before enabling signed artifacts

The Quillbase pipeline rejects artifact signatures when build agents drift more than the allowed skew from the timestamping service. Before proceeding, confirm every agent in the Ostermark pool syncs against the internal time source, since signature validity windows are derived from agent clocks. A reviewer should verify the skew tolerances are not loosened beyond policy. The enforced time-sync configuration is as follows.

deployment values, tafof-taduf:
pelius:
  pin: 6508
  tenant: praiel
  seal: seal_4e33a2f4
  metrics_host: metrics.pelius.plorvagrid.corp
  standby_team: druix
  escalation: juldor-norius
  nonce: 5db598

Subject: TumbleKey locker access flow — v2.4 rolling out

Team, the updated TumbleKey access flow ships to all laundry-locker kiosks tonight. Users now get a single-use unlock code instead of the persistent PIN; expired codes show a retry prompt rather than a hard error. Expect a brief bump in "code not working" tickets during the cutover. When filing escalations, please quote the build token below.

session token of kawip-kadup = htk6_e0d771